Tianhe supercomputer ranked world's fourth fastest

Beijing. October 30. INTERFAX-CHINA - The National University of Defense Technology (NUDT) in Changsha, Hunan Province, has developed Tianhe, a supercomputer with the capacity to theoretically conduct over 1 quadrillion calculations per second (one petaflop) at peak speed, the world's fourth fastest, according to an Oct. 29 NUDT announcement.
